Driving force analysis and risk assessment of flash flood disaster based on multi-parameter optimized geographic detector
[Objective]Datong City is located in the northeast edge of Loess Plateau,and the frequent underground mining activi-ties in the region aggravate the flash flood disaster,which seriously threatens people's life and property safety.In order to reveal the main driving forces of flash flood disaster in this region and evaluate its risk,[Methods]based on the result of the flash flood disasters investigation and evaluation project in Datong City,multi-scale grids were sampled and optimal geographical detector was used to discretize continuous driving factors optimally.The explanatory power of the driving factors of flash flood disasters and the average hazard level of each driving factor were calculated.Finally,a quantitative risk assessment was conducted based on the obtained explanatory power and hazard level.[Results]The result show that:Rainfall is the primary factor inducing flash floods(q=0.0888),followed by human activities(q=0.0618)and the surface environment is the weakest(q=0.0227).Among the selected rainfall indicators,6 h heavy rainfall has the strongest average explanatory power(q=0.1412)for the occur-rence of flash floods in Datong City,which can be taken into account in the further study of critical rainfall for flash floods.In Datong City,the risk level of flash floods disaster is high,the area of medium and above risk areas accounts for more than 3/5,and the density of disaster points in high risk areas is 0.0385/km2.[Conclusion]The optimization of grid scale and discrete mode can effectively improve the interpretation power of Geographic Detector analysis result.Short-duration(<6 h)heavy rain-fall,if not sustained,the induced intensity of flash floods disaster is greatly reduced.Overall,the risk level of flash floods in Da-tong City is relatively high,and they are mainly concentrated in areas with lower vulnerability levels.The result of the study can provide a reference for quantitatively evaluating the riskiness of flash floods,and provide a certain scientific basis for flash flood prevention and control zoning in Datong City.
